Job Description
Full Time or Part Time: Full time
Job Purpose:
As a research analyst, a prospective student will be exposed to the clinical, operative, and academic side of medicine. While experiencing the field of orthopaedic surgery hands-on, the analyst will assist two trauma physicians in continuing their extensive research being conducted for the field as a whole, while also observing care of their patients- whether in the clinic or the operating room.
MUSC Minimum Requirement:
A high school diploma and two years clerical or paraprofessional experience involving the compilation of data and statistics. A bachelor's degree may be substituted for the required work experience.
Additional Knowledge, skill, ability preferred:
The applicant should have a strong academic record, must be creative, self-driven, reliable, and motivated to learn. An ideal candidate will have been previously involved in clinical or basic research and demonstrated interest in academic medicine. The position offers the opportunity for education and hands-on learning in the medical field. Some experience with data management preferred, although not required.
Guideline and Supervision:
Research assistants will work closely with Dr. Hartsock, Dr. Reid and our MUSC Orthopaedic Surgery Residents.
Job Duties:
· Completing data analysis and manuscript preparation for scientific publication. Complete corrections and suggestions from scientific publication editors. 25%
· Recruiting patients and collecting data for research studies. Attend clinic with supporting physicians and program coordinator to help consent study candidates and collect study data. 25%
· Supporting physicians with ongoing studies, projects, videos, papers and presentations. Give guidance and support for Orthopaedic residents on ongoing orthopaedic studies. 15%
· Drafting grant proposals for internal and extramural funding announcements. Complete information in clinialresearch.org and other research databases. 10%
· Gathering patient images, X-rays, as well as operative and clinical notes and videos. Attend surgery cases to video cases at the direction of the surgeon. Upload CT scans for software preparation for Total Shoulder Arthroplasty cases. 10%
· Assembling surgeon’s presentations and case reports. Create and submit presentations for Orthopaedics organizations. Prepare information for supporting surgeons’ cases for presentation at weekly pediatric orthopaedic conference. 10%
· Drafting Institutional Review Board documentation for research studies. Drafting of protocols for new research studies with the guidance of supporting physicians. 5%
